proxyphylline
Known as:
Beta-Oxypropyltheophyllin
, 1H-Purine-2,6-dione, 3,7-dihydro-1,3-dimethyl-7-(2-hydroxypropyl)-
, 1,3-Dimethyl-7-(2-hydroxypropyl)xanthine
Expand
A methylxanthine and derivative of theophylline. Proxyphylline relaxes smooth muscles, particularly bronchial muscles. This xanthine most likely…
